Output 58ad4369f652c5f168baadd37884325e7e2e451cc9d0ec33b85ad9ff6bf9ad47:76

value
3680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f15270d9a52e2ec362e5edce805c564316f341 OP_EQUAL
address
3EGPbB1fJBVN1svG2UQqLAunS9PYa5oGC6
transaction
58ad4369f652c5f168baadd37884325e7e2e451cc9d0ec33b85ad9ff6bf9ad47
spent
true